SLD327YT 3W High Power Laser Diode

The SLD327YT has a compatible package, and allows independent thermal and electric design. It is a high power laser diode that affords easy optical design. Features


• High-optical power output Recommended optical power output: PO = 3.0W
• High-optical power density: 3W/200µm (Emitting line width) Applications
• Solid state laser excitation
• Medical use
• Material processing
• Measurement Structure AlGaAs quantum well structure laser diode Operating Lifetime MTTF 10,000H (effective value) at Po = 3.0W, Tth = 25°C Absolute Maximum Ratings (Tth = 25°C)
• Optical power output PO 3.3
• Reverse voltage VRLD 2 PD 15
• Operating temperature (Tth) Topr
  –10 to +30
• Storage temperature Tstg
  –40 to +85 M-288 Equivalent Circuit TE Cooler Case LD TH PD 1 3 4 5.
